It's a pretty interesting anime so far. It's about a what-if a country called Britannia (Apparently it's a mix of Britain and America) took over Japan with something called Knightmare Frames, giant rollerblading robots. They renamed Japan to Area11, and call Japanese people 11's. There's a bunch of resistences a couple years later that don't amount to much, and the story centers around a Britannian teenager named Lelouche who's really the 17th heir to the Britannian throne, but due to circumstances he wants to overthrow Britannia.

So far it's a really interesting show, and I think some people might like it despite the mecha in it. I'm addicted so far and I haven't felt this addicted since Gundam SEED DESTINY started airing. Then again I knew GSD wasn't exactly a masterpiece, but I still enjoyed it.

On a side note, CLAMP designed the characters and animated/produced by Sunrise, a company that has done pretty much every Gundam Series to date.
